The National Committee on Radiation Protection principle to keep exposure down, based on the idea

that all radiation, no matter how small the dose, may cause adverse biological effects, is called "ALARA."

Indicate whether the statement is true or false


True. The ALARA concept implies that any radiation dose that can be reduced without major difficulty, great expense, or inconvenience should be reduced or eliminated.
